Equivalent de la touche "tab" mais avec la touche "Enter" [vb.net ]

Equivalent de la touche "tab" mais avec la touche "Enter" [vb.net ] - VB/VBA/VBS - Programmation

Marsh Posté le 31-05-2005 à 13:28:58    

Bonjour,
 
J'expose l'énoncé du pb : quand l'utilisateur a terminé une saisie dans une textbox, j'aimerai que la touche "Enter" permette de passer le focus à un autre contrôle sur le formulaire.
 
Je pense que l'événement KeyPress sur la textbox est celui à utiliser, par contre, je ne sais pas comment tester si c'est bien la touche "Enter" qui a été pressée !
 
Merci pour votre aide !
 
Alex

Reply

Marsh Posté le 31-05-2005 à 13:28:58   

Reply

Marsh Posté le 31-05-2005 à 14:50:12    

J'ai finalement trouvé ce que je cherchais, je mets le code, ca pourra peut-être intéresser qqun (je cherchais à passer d'une textbox à une autre en pressant la touche "Enter" ) :

Code :
  1. Private Sub txtBox1_KeyDown(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les txtBoxRef.KeyDown
  2.         If e.KeyCode = Keys.Enter Then
  3.             txtBox2.Focus()
  4.         End If
  5.     End Sub


 
Alex

Reply

Marsh Posté le 22-06-2005 à 09:32:54    

Nikel!!!
Exactement ce que je cherchais!!
Merci bcp Alex d'avoir pensé aux autres et d'avoir mis la solution que tu avais trouvé!
Si seuleument tout le monde pouvais faire comme toi.....!
@+
Phil

Reply

Marsh Posté le 22-06-2005 à 11:00:24    

De rien Phil...
J'me suis dit que ca pouvait servir !!!
 
A+
 
Alex

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ed